通过与 Jira 对比,让您更全面了解 PingCode

  • 首页
  • 需求与产品管理
  • 项目管理
  • 测试与缺陷管理
  • 知识管理
  • 效能度量
        • 更多产品

          客户为中心的产品管理工具

          专业的软件研发项目管理工具

          简单易用的团队知识库管理

          可量化的研发效能度量工具

          测试用例维护与计划执行

          以团队为中心的协作沟通

          研发工作流自动化工具

          账号认证与安全管理工具

          Why PingCode
          为什么选择 PingCode ?

          6000+企业信赖之选,为研发团队降本增效

        • 行业解决方案
          先进制造(即将上线)
        • 解决方案1
        • 解决方案2
  • Jira替代方案

25人以下免费

目录

软件如何做好项目经理

软件如何做好项目经理

软件做好项目经理需要:掌握项目管理工具、制定详细的项目计划、建立有效的沟通机制、进行风险管理、持续监控和改进项目进展、培养团队成员的技能、合理分配资源、灵活应对变更。 掌握项目管理工具是最基础且最重要的一点。这是因为项目管理工具能够帮助项目经理更好地规划、执行和监控项目进度,从而确保项目按时、按质、按预算完成。通过项目管理工具,项目经理可以实时跟踪项目的进展,及时发现和解决问题,提高项目的成功率。

一、掌握项目管理工具

项目管理工具对于一个项目经理而言是不可或缺的。常见的项目管理工具包括JIRA、Asana、Trello、Microsoft Project等。掌握这些工具不仅能提高工作效率,还能使项目管理更加规范和透明。

  1. JIRA:JIRA 是一个非常流行的项目管理工具,特别适用于软件开发项目。它提供了丰富的功能,如任务跟踪、问题管理、敏捷开发等。通过JIRA,项目经理可以方便地创建和分配任务,跟踪任务进度,管理项目的各个环节。

  2. Asana:Asana 是一个非常灵活的项目管理工具,适用于各种类型的项目。它提供了任务管理、时间跟踪、团队协作等功能。通过Asana,项目经理可以轻松地制定项目计划,分配任务,跟踪项目进展,提高团队的协作效率。

二、制定详细的项目计划

详细的项目计划是项目成功的基础。项目计划包括项目目标、范围、时间安排、资源分配、风险管理等内容。项目经理需要根据项目的特点和要求,制定详细的项目计划,并确保所有团队成员都了解并遵守项目计划。

  1. 确定项目目标和范围:项目目标和范围是项目计划的核心内容。项目经理需要与客户和团队成员充分沟通,明确项目的目标和范围,确保项目的方向和目标一致。

  2. 制定时间安排和里程碑:时间安排和里程碑是项目计划的重要组成部分。项目经理需要根据项目的目标和范围,制定详细的时间安排和里程碑,确保项目按计划进行。

三、建立有效的沟通机制

有效的沟通机制是项目成功的关键。项目经理需要建立良好的沟通机制,确保团队成员之间的信息畅通,及时解决问题,提高团队的协作效率。

  1. 定期召开项目会议:定期召开项目会议是建立有效沟通机制的重要手段。项目经理可以通过项目会议,了解项目的进展,解决项目中的问题,确保项目按计划进行。

  2. 使用沟通工具:沟通工具是提高沟通效率的重要手段。项目经理可以使用Slack、Microsoft Teams等沟通工具,与团队成员保持实时沟通,及时解决问题,提高团队的协作效率。

四、进行风险管理

风险管理是项目管理中的重要环节。项目经理需要识别项目中的潜在风险,制定风险应对措施,确保项目能够顺利进行。

  1. 识别风险:风险识别是风险管理的第一步。项目经理需要识别项目中的潜在风险,包括技术风险、资源风险、时间风险等,确保项目能够顺利进行。

  2. 制定风险应对措施:制定风险应对措施是风险管理的重要环节。项目经理需要根据识别到的风险,制定相应的风险应对措施,确保项目能够顺利进行。

五、持续监控和改进项目进展

持续监控和改进项目进展是项目成功的重要保障。项目经理需要实时监控项目的进展,及时发现和解决问题,确保项目按计划进行。

  1. 实时监控项目进展:实时监控项目进展是项目管理的重要环节。项目经理需要通过项目管理工具,实时监控项目的进展,及时发现和解决问题,确保项目按计划进行。

  2. 定期评估和改进:定期评估和改进是项目成功的重要保障。项目经理需要定期评估项目的进展,总结项目中的问题和经验,及时改进项目的管理方法,提高项目的成功率。

六、培养团队成员的技能

团队成员的技能是项目成功的重要因素。项目经理需要关注团队成员的技能培养,提供必要的培训和支持,确保团队成员能够胜任项目的工作,提高团队的整体能力。

  1. 提供培训和支持:提供培训和支持是团队成员技能培养的重要手段。项目经理需要根据团队成员的需求,提供相应的培训和支持,确保团队成员能够胜任项目的工作,提高团队的整体能力。

  2. 鼓励团队成员学习和成长:鼓励团队成员学习和成长是提高团队能力的重要手段。项目经理需要鼓励团队成员不断学习和成长,提高自身的能力,为项目的成功提供有力的保障。

七、合理分配资源

合理分配资源是项目成功的重要保障。项目经理需要根据项目的需求,合理分配资源,确保项目能够顺利进行。

  1. 资源需求分析:资源需求分析是合理分配资源的基础。项目经理需要根据项目的需求,进行资源需求分析,确保项目能够顺利进行。

  2. 资源分配和调度:资源分配和调度是项目管理的重要环节。项目经理需要根据资源需求分析,合理分配和调度资源,确保项目能够顺利进行。

八、灵活应对变更

项目在进行过程中,难免会遇到各种变更。项目经理需要具备灵活应对变更的能力,及时调整项目计划和资源分配,确保项目能够顺利进行。

  1. 变更管理流程:变更管理流程是灵活应对变更的重要手段。项目经理需要建立变更管理流程,确保项目变更能够及时处理,减少对项目的影响。

  2. 灵活调整项目计划:灵活调整项目计划是应对变更的重要手段。项目经理需要根据项目的变更情况,及时调整项目计划和资源分配,确保项目能够顺利进行。

综上所述,软件做好项目经理需要掌握项目管理工具、制定详细的项目计划、建立有效的沟通机制、进行风险管理、持续监控和改进项目进展、培养团队成员的技能、合理分配资源、灵活应对变更。通过这些措施,项目经理可以提高项目的成功率,确保项目按时、按质、按预算完成。

相关问答FAQs:

如何提高软件项目经理的领导能力?
要提高软件项目经理的领导能力,可以通过参与领导力培训、阅读相关书籍、以及向经验丰富的领导者学习来实现。此外,实践是关键,多参与团队管理和决策过程,能够有效提升领导技巧。

软件项目经理需要掌握哪些关键技能?
软件项目经理应具备多种技能,包括项目规划、风险管理、沟通能力和团队协作能力。技术知识也是不可或缺的,理解软件开发流程和工具将有助于更好地管理团队和项目进度。

在面对项目延期时,项目经理应采取哪些应对措施?
面对项目延期,项目经理应首先分析延期的原因,并与团队进行沟通,寻找解决方案。调整项目计划、优先级和资源分配也是必要的步骤。同时,向利益相关者及时通报情况,以保持透明度和信任度。